Transaction 625ea319caa25805091fe182f6ec1fdf91c4a0a14ab06eb791432ef061affa23
1 Input
1 Output
-
625ea319caa25805091fe182f6ec1fdf91c4a0a14ab06eb791432ef061affa23:0
- value
- 1517204
- script pubkey
- OP_0 OP_PUSHBYTES_20 75e1365233102820e9be7294f16c6c08cc02ff0d
- address
- bc1qwhsnv53nzq5zp6d7w220zmrvprxq9lcd9yqzgz